How they compare

Iraq currently reports 63.91 grams per day per capita against 62.58 grams per day per capita in Afghanistan, a difference of 1.33 grams per day per capita.

The two have swapped places 9 times across 63 shared years of data; in 1961 it was Afghanistan ahead.

Afghanistan ranks 165th and Iraq ranks 162nd of 192 countries.

Across the 7 decades both report, Afghanistan averaged higher in 6 and Iraq in 1.

Head to head by decade

Decade Afghanistan Iraq Difference Ahead
1960s 80.6 grams per day per capita 55.97 grams per day per capita 24.63 grams per day per capita Afghanistan
1970s 73.7 grams per day per capita 59.81 grams per day per capita 13.89 grams per day per capita Afghanistan
1980s 71.99 grams per day per capita 82.14 grams per day per capita 10.14 grams per day per capita Iraq
1990s 58.08 grams per day per capita 53.31 grams per day per capita 4.77 grams per day per capita Afghanistan
2000s 55.5 grams per day per capita 54.67 grams per day per capita 0.8323 grams per day per capita Afghanistan
2010s 63.85 grams per day per capita 58.91 grams per day per capita 4.94 grams per day per capita Afghanistan
2020s 62.17 grams per day per capita 61.35 grams per day per capita 0.8266 grams per day per capita Afghanistan

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
